CAS 42143-23-7: 5,6-Quinolinediamine
Description:5,6-Quinolinediamine, with the CAS number 42143-23-7, is an organic compound characterized by its quinoline structure, which consists of a bicyclic aromatic system containing a nitrogen atom. This compound features two amino groups (-NH2) located at the 5 and 6 positions of the quinoline ring, contributing to its reactivity and potential applications in various fields. It is typically a solid at room temperature and may exhibit solubility in polar solvents due to the presence of the amino groups. The compound is of interest in medicinal chemistry and materials science, as it can serve as a precursor for the synthesis of dyes, pharmaceuticals, and other nitrogen-containing heterocycles. Additionally, its ability to form coordination complexes with metals can be explored for catalytic applications. Safety data indicates that, like many amines, it should be handled with care due to potential toxicity and irritant properties. Overall, 5,6-Quinolinediamine is a versatile compound with significant implications in chemical research and industrial applications.
Formula:C9H9N3
